Looking for some help/advice out flying to the Superbowl. Boss got tickets now wants to fly.

Called JAX Signature and they are not taking anymore planes. Sending all other planes to Cecil Fld. Already know about the slot times (72hrs prior). Just looking for some experienced help.

just because JAX isn't "taking anymore planes" i'm not sure that doesn't mean you can just drop off and make a quick turn to another airport to park........


please correct me folks if i'm wrong
 
In all STMP situations, there is ALWAYS the availability to drop and go. You may face delays in arrivals/departures, but that option always exsists.
